Misconceptions about psychology
and psychologists:
 
Anybody who has studied psychology can
read
people’s personality
Psychologists can predict fate or destiny
Psychologists are doctors
Psychologists give medicines
Definition:

“Psychology is the scientific study


of human behavior and mental
processes….human or animal.”
Goals of Psychology:
 To understand the nature and
mechanisms of behavior and mental
processes 
 To develop an understanding of the
relationship between behavior and
mental processes 
 To apply this understanding to real life
situations and, on the basis of this
understanding, predict for the future
  To employ the scientific approach for
developing this understanding
 
Scientific nature of Psychology:
 Psychology is a science. It employs the
scientific method for gathering knowledge
and information.
 Scientific method is a systematic and
organized series of steps that scientists
adopt for exploring any phenomenon in
order to obtain accurate and consistent
results.These steps involve observation,
description, control, and replication
 Remember ! Science does not deal with
the supernatural
 
Scope of psychology
After doing a degree course in psychology
one may join a variety of work settings:
Education/teaching
Research
Hospitals/clinics
Recruiting/screening agencies
Specialized professional settings
Popular areas of psychology

 Clinical psychology
 Industrial/Organizational psychology
 Health psychology psychology
 Consumer psychology
 Environmental psychology
 Sport psychology
 Forensic psychology
